Jessica Violetta is an Artist and Textile Designer based in the New York City metro area.

Her work honors the power of nature and its impact on the human experience. By weaving together organic forms that echo and embrace each other, Jessica creates enveloping works of art that reflect the beautiful complexity of our existence.

Born in Northern California and raised in New Jersey, Jessica has always been inspired by the drama of nature. She attended a performing arts high school for dance and theatre before returning to San Francisco to receive a BFA from California College of the Arts. She has since worked with clients such as Pottery Barn, West Elm, Altuzarra, Monique Lhuillier, Julia Berolzheimer, David Burke, and more.

Violetta now paints and designs from her home studio just a boat ride from Manhattan, immersed in coastal nature.
